两江假日酒店公司市场化选聘首批职业经理人
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2025-11-27 10:52
Core Insights - The signing of the first batch of professional managers by Chongqing Cultural Tourism Group marks a significant step in the reform of state-owned enterprises, emphasizing the "talent-driven enterprise" strategy and the implementation of the "three systems reform" [1][4] Group 1: Professional Manager Recruitment - Nearly 500 valid resumes were received for the management positions, with selected candidates having strong industry backgrounds, including 3 from foreign hotel groups like Marriott and 7 from leading domestic hotel companies [3] - The professional managers will sign a contract that includes a three-year operational goal, with a compensation structure that emphasizes performance, where basic salary accounts for no more than 30% and performance-related pay exceeds 70% [3] Group 2: Strategic Goals and Integration - The reform is a key initiative for the professional integration of hotels in Chongqing, aiming to shift from "physical merger" to "chemical integration" by introducing professional management talent [3] - The group plans to leverage the expertise of the new managers to enhance brand restructuring and operational upgrades, focusing on creating a brand matrix centered around "Two Rivers Holiday" and "Chongqing Hotel" [3] Group 3: Market-Oriented Management - The signing represents a bold exploration of the "three systems reform," breaking away from traditional administrative hiring practices in state-owned enterprises [4] - The new management system introduces market-oriented selection, contractual management, differentiated compensation, and market-based exit strategies, aiming to invigorate the talent pool within state-owned enterprises [4]
